Start Back Next End
  
8
dilanjutkan dengan proses planning, modeling, construction,deployment, dan
berakhir pada dukungan bagi software yang sudah selesai.
Penggunaan model
Waterfall dikarenakan  kebutuhan yang diperlukan dalam menyelesaikan suatu
masalah sudah diketahui.
Gambar 2.1 Waterfall Model
Dalam dunia nyata, penggunaan model ini memiliki masalah yang cukup
dominan. Salah satu masalah tersebut adalah penggunaan model ini tidak
memungkinkan perubahan, karena perubahan sekecil apapun dapat memimbulkan
kebingungan dalam tim proyek. Terlebih, para stakeholder sulit untuk
menjabarkan kebutuhan yang mereka inginkan secara inplisit. Adapun kelebihan
penggunaan model waterfall adalah
dengan
model ini dokumentasi
pengembangan sistem menjadi sangat teroganisir karena harus setiap fase harus
terselesaikan sebelum dapat ke fase berikutnya.
2.1.3
Unified Modelling Languages
Menurut
(Lethbridge & Laganiere, 2005),
Unified Modelling Language
(UML) merupakan standar bahasa grafis untuk pemodelan perangkat lunak
berorientasi objek. Dikembangkan pada pertengahan tahun 1990-an sebagai
hasil
Word to PDF Converter | Word to HTML Converter